Trading rebates are cashback rewards you earn for every trade you make. Instead of paying the full trading cost to your broker, a portion is returned back to you.
Rebates refund part of the spread or commission you pay on each trade. This lowers your overall cost per lot, helping you save money even if your strategy stays the same and no matter what your profit/loss is.

Brokers share a portion of their revenue with partners who help bring or support traders. Offering rebates is simply a way to attract more active clients.
We pay out rebates usually monthly or weekly, depending on the broker you choose.
Brokers give partners (IBs) a small commission for bringing clients. RebateRider shares most of that commission back with you as cashback.
